AI solutions and SaaS platform for enterprise automation and analytics
PKSHA Technology builds AI solutions and SaaS products for enterprise customers across Japan and globally. The stack reveals a modern, polyglot engineering approach—TypeScript/Next.js for frontend, Python for ML, Go and Java for backend services—deployed on AWS and Azure with heavy use of containerization (Docker, Terraform, CDK). The hiring velocity is accelerating with a 19-person engineering org actively recruiting senior and mid-level roles across multiple countries, while simultaneously scaling sales (8 roles) and product (6 roles), suggesting aggressive expansion into new SaaS products and verticals.

PKSHA Technology develops AI solutions and SaaS products focused on enterprise automation, worker platforms, and business intelligence. The company operates across multiple product lines including a meeting transcription service (Yomel), an AI help desk, a chat agent platform, and recruitment and staffing services. With 501–1,000 employees and headquartered in Bunkyo, Tokyo, the company is publicly traded and operates a distributed hiring footprint across Europe, India, and Africa. Core technical challenges include integrating AI into legacy systems, scaling their development organization, and modernizing internal infrastructure while launching new features.
PKSHA uses TypeScript, Next.js, React on frontend; Python, Go, Java for backend; AWS, Azure, GCP for cloud infrastructure; Docker and Terraform for deployment; and OpenAI APIs for AI features.
Active products include Yomel (meeting transcription), an AI help desk, a chat agent platform, a professional worker platform, and recruitment BPO services. The company is also working on broader AI transformation initiatives and new SaaS launches.
